One of the most powerful elements of the new ASP.NET Dynamic Data feature we are working on is the ability to associate metadata (for example, range validation or formatting) with your data model. You can then query the model and use the provided information to customize the processing of your data. In the recently released ASP.NET 3.5 Extensions Preview this annotation is done by declaring special metadata attributes on the partial classes representing the entities in the model. The initial implementation is a bit limited, however, because the metadata association can only be done using CLR attributes and those attributes have to be declared on the class (even if they pertain to the class's properties):
[Range("Quantity", 0, 10000)] [Range("Price", 0, 20000)] partial class Product { }

Buddy class metadata is a model in which you associate a "buddy class" with your actual data model class and declare the metadata attributes on properties of the buddy class. "Why do I need to declare a parallel class?", you ask. The simple answer is that the current versions of C# and VB have no concept of partial properties.
This implementation supports two ways of associating the buddy class:
Using the explicit option looks like this:
[MetadataClass(typeof(Product_Metadata))] partial class Product { } public class Product_Metadata { [Range(0, 10000)] public int Quantity { get; set; } }
Comment out the MetadataClass attribute and you get the implicit option.
An alternative metadata provider uses an XML file as the metadata store. Currently the file location is hard-coded to be ~/metadata.xml. A very basic metadata.xml file could look like this (a slightly bigger one is included in the sample blog project of the MVC Toolkit):
<metadata xmlns="http://tempuri.org/metadataFile" xmlns:m="http://tempuri.org/metadataElements" xmlns:xsi="http://www.w3.org/2001/XMLSchema-instance" xsi:schemaLocation="http://tempuri.org/metadataFile ../Schemas/MetadataFile.xsd http://tempuri.org/metadataElements ../Schemas/MetadataElements.xsd"> <metadataAttributes> <metadataAttribute tagPrefix="m" assembly="MVCToolkit" namespace="Microsoft.Web.DynamicData.Metadata"/> </metadataAttributes> <tables> <table name="Product"> <columns> <column name="Quantity"> <m:Range Minimum="0" Maximum="100000"/> </column> </columns> </table> </tables> </metadata>
The metadataAttributes section defines metadata attribute mappings. These are used by the logic that creates a CLR attribute type instance from an XML element. For example, the m:Range element will be converted into the class Microsoft.Web.DynamicData.Metadata.RangeAttribute in the MVCToolkit assembly. The attributes on the element are automatically converted and set on the properties of the attribute type instance. You can add your own metadata attribute collection by defining a new metadataAttribute entry.
The tables section allows you to define metadata on all of the tables and their columns that make up your model.
As a final note, most of the attributes on the root metadata element are there to support IntelliSense in your XML editor. The relative URLs work in the sample Dynamic Data MVC blog project. You might have to change some of the paths if you decide to move the XSD files around or if you create a new project in a different location.
The underlying implementation uses the TypeDescriptor mechanism from System.ComponentModel. It is basically a pluggable layer on top of standard reflection. Have a look at the code to learn more.
